What is an eSIM QR Code?
An eSIM QR code is a digital activation key that contains the information needed to download and install your eSIM profile onto your device. Unlike a physical SIM card that you insert, an eSIM is built into your phone's hardware and is activated by scanning this QR code. Think of it as a digital "key" that unlocks your mobile connection without requiring a plastic card.
The QR code typically contains your mobile number (MSISDN) and ICCID mapped to an eSIM profile. Once you scan it, your device downloads the eSIM profile from your network operator and activates your mobile account.

For Traditional Operators (Jazz, Zong, Ufone)
To get a QR code for a local eSIM, you must visit a service center in person. After biometric verification, you receive a physical voucher containing a QR code. This QR code is linked specifically to your mobile number and should not be shared with anyone.
-
Jazz: Visit a Jazz Experience Center, Franchise, or eligible retailer
-
Zong: Visit a Zong Customer Service Centre or Franchise
For Travel eSIMs
Travel eSIM QR codes are delivered digitally. After purchasing a plan online, the QR code is sent to your email or made available in the provider's app. You can download and install it on your device before traveling, typically in 2–5 minutes.
For Onic (Digital-First Network)
Onic offers fully digital eSIM activation. You receive your QR code digitally through the Onic app or website after completing verification.
How to Scan an eSIM QR Code
Step-by-Step: Scan on iPhone
-
Connect to Wi-Fi – Ensure your phone has an active internet connection
-
Open Settings – Go to Settings on your iPhone
-
Tap Cellular – Select Cellular or Mobile Data
-
Add Cellular Plan – Tap "Add Cellular Plan"
-
Scan the QR Code – Your camera will launch automatically. Position the QR code in the frame
-
Follow Prompts – Complete the on-screen instructions to download the profile
-
Your eSIM is active – Activation takes 5 minutes or less
Step-by-Step: Scan on Android
-
Connect to Wi-Fi – Ensure your phone is connected to the internet
-
Open Settings – Go to your device Settings
-
SIM Card Manager – Navigate to SIM Card Manager
-
Select eSIM – Tap on eSIM
-
Add Mobile Plan – Tap "Add Mobile Plan"
-
Scan the QR Code – Use your camera to scan the QR code
-
Follow Prompts – Complete the installation
What If I Only Have One Device?
If you received your eSIM QR code by email and can't print it, you can still activate it:
On Android
Take a screenshot of the QR code, then in the scanner screen, tap the gallery icon (bottom right) and select the screenshot.
On Pixel Phones
Go to the Photos app, long press the QR code image, and tap "Add eSIM".
On iPhone
If you see the QR code on your device screen, hard press it and select "Add eSIM".
Important Notes About eSIM QR Codes
Security Warning
Do not share your eSIM QR code with anyone. It is linked directly to your mobile number. If someone else scans it, they could activate your number on their device.
Reusing the QR Code
-
Zong: You can rescan the same QR code if you change your phone or delete the eSIM profile
-
Jazz: The QR code can be re-used if it has been properly removed or deleted from the previous handset
Factory Reset Warning
If you factory reset your phone, your eSIM activation will be lost. For Jazz users, you need to visit a Jazz Experience Center, Franchise, or eligible retailer again to get a new QR code.
PTA Registration Requirement
Your eSIM activates a specific IMEI on your phone. To avoid blocking in DIRBS, send both IMEIs to 8484 and email screenshots to typeapproval@pta.gov.pk for whitelisting.
Guide Information
Eligibility
- A device that supports eSIM technology
- For local operator eSIM: Valid CNIC for biometric verification
- For travel eSIMs: eSIM-compatible device only
Required Documents
For Jazz, Zong, Ufone:
- Valid CNIC for in-person biometric verification
- PTA-registered device
For Travel eSIMs:
- No documents required
- Only need an eSIM-compatible device
Fees
Jazz eSIM: Rs. 2,000Zong eSIM: Rs. 2,000Travel eSIMs: Starting from Rs 554 / €1.29
Processing Time
QR Code Delivery: Immediate (in-person or email)eSIM Activation: 1-5 minutes
